INCOMING MESSAGE
I am Tano Olazzar, one of the emissaries tasked with leading Earth to greatness and raising its civilization from the ashes. I will be your ally and advisor on this difficult journey.
The All-Mind's triumph and the subsequent genocide of the human race have left emissaries as the only wielders of power on this planet. To the cradle of humanity, we bring our greatest gifts: the might of edicts and long-lost knowledge.
By my will alone an oasis can spring up in the middle of a desert, seas may rise where mountains once stood. Earth, however, remains hostile to our species.
Tumblr media
Upon my reawakening, I had to rely on edicts to expand arable land as far as the eye could see, all to feed my people. Wielding the power of a kind word and a good deed, I was building a new future for humanity. And as soon as I thought that nothing could stand in my way, an army appeared on the horizon.
The enemy troops were too many to count, while my warriors were weak and poorly trained. We had enough food to survive a siege, but that too could end in our defeat. Reluctantly, I made a decision. Using the power of edicts, I've lowered the temperature of the surrounding lands to slow the foe’s advance. Enemy soldiers found themselves stuck in snow banks for months, their arrows disappearing into the blinding whiteness of a summoned snowstorm and never reaching their targets.  
Alas, I made a mistake - the river that used to safeguard the city on one side was frozen over, creating a passageway for our adversaries.
Tumblr media
Never, in my previous life, have I served as a general in combat. That lack of experience cost us dearly. While my maneuvers earned the city enough time to train more soldiers, we lost fertile land surrounding the settlement. Existing supplies were being consumed at an alarming rate, signaling the oncoming famine. A painful lesson on the destructive power of edicts used even with the best of intentions.
Never since the All-Mind’s creation had humanity wielded such might. It may lead us to greatness or to the destruction of Earth. Forever, this time.
Take the time to study this new world you have found yourself in and remember - Earth's future is now your burden to bear.
